Planning commission tables bylaws redline to July 2 after limited review time
Summary
Commission Chair MacPhail said a redlined draft of bylaw changes was circulated the same day; the commission agreed to table discussion and consider the edits at the July 2 public hearing.

Chair MacPhail told the commission that a redline document showing proposed bylaw edits had been distributed that day but that most commissioners had not had the opportunity to review it. Because of the limited review time, she recommended tabling discussion of the bylaw edits until the commission's next public hearing on July 2, 2025.
Commissioners raised no objections to tabling the item and the chair confirmed the bylaw discussion will be placed on the July 2 agenda. Commissioners and staff emphasized they would review the redline before that meeting.
The decision to postpone gave commissioners additional time to read the redline and prepare any suggested amendments or questions for the July 2 meeting.
